Какой оператор SQL используется для создания таблицы в базе данных?

Для создания таблицы в базе данных используется оператор CREATE TABLE в SQL.

Пример создания таблицы с именем "users" и двумя столбцами:


CREATE TABLE users (
    id INT PRIMARY KEY,
    name VARCHAR(50)
);
    

В этом примере, мы создаем таблицу "users" с двумя столбцами: "id" с типом данных INT и ограничением PRIMARY KEY, а также "name" с типом данных VARCHAR(50).

Детальный ответ

Привет! Рад видеть тебя здесь. Сегодня мы поговорим о том, как создать таблицу в базе данных с помощью оператора SQL. SQL (Structured Query Language) - язык программирования, который используется для работы с базами данных. Он позволяет нам выполнять различные операции, такие как создание, добавление, изменение и удаление данных из базы данных.

Чтобы создать таблицу в базе данных, мы используем оператор CREATE TABLE. Он позволяет задать структуру таблицы и определить ее столбцы и их типы данных.

Вот простой пример оператора CREATE TABLE:

CREATE TABLE students (
    id INT,
    name VARCHAR(50),
    age INT
);

В этом примере мы создаем таблицу с именем "students" и определяем три столбца: "id" с типом данных INT (целое число), "name" с типом данных VARCHAR(50) (строка с максимальной длиной 50 символов) и "age" с типом данных INT.

Как видишь, каждый столбец таблицы имеет свой тип данных. SQL предоставляет различные типы данных, такие как INT, VARCHAR, TEXT, DATE и т.д. Ты можешь выбрать подходящий тип данных в зависимости от характеристик данных, которые ты собираешься хранить в таблице.

Оператор CREATE TABLE также позволяет нам указать дополнительные ограничения для столбцов, такие как NOT NULL (не может быть пустым), UNIQUE (уникальное значение) и FOREIGN KEY (внешний ключ). Вот пример таблицы с ограничениями:

CREATE TABLE orders (
    id INT PRIMARY KEY,
    customer_id INT,
    product_id INT,
    quantity INT,
    FOREIGN KEY (customer_id) REFERENCES customers(id),
    FOREIGN KEY (product_id) REFERENCES products(id)
);

В этом примере мы создаем таблицу "orders" с ограничениями PRIMARY KEY (первичный ключ) на столбце "id" и двумя внешними ключами. Внешние ключи связывают столбцы таблицы "orders" со столбцами таблиц "customers" и "products". Это позволяет нам создавать связи между таблицами и обеспечивать целостность данных.

Также можно добавить другие ограничения, такие как CHECK (проверка условия) и DEFAULT (значение по умолчанию), когда мы создаем таблицу. Ограничения позволяют нам внести ограничения на данные, которые могут быть вставлены в таблицу.

Например, вот таблица с ограничениями CHECK и DEFAULT:

CREATE TABLE employees (
    id INT PRIMARY KEY,
    name VARCHAR(50),
    age INT,
    salary DECIMAL(10,2) DEFAULT 0.0,
    CHECK (age >= 18)
);

В этом примере мы создаем таблицу "employees" с ограничением CHECK, которое проверяет, что значение столбца "age" больше или равно 18. Мы также устанавливаем значение по умолчанию для столбца "salary" равное 0.0, чтобы все новые записи имели начальное значение.

Теперь, когда ты знаешь, как использовать оператор CREATE TABLE для создания таблицы в базе данных, ты можешь приступить к созданию своей собственной таблицы. Помни, что правильное определение структуры таблицы очень важно, чтобы ты мог эффективно хранить и обрабатывать данные в своей базе данных.

Надеюсь, эта статья помогла тебе понять, как использовать оператор SQL для создания таблицы в базе данных. Удачи в твоих будущих проектах!

Видео по теме

#13. Создание таблиц в базе данных (create table) | Основы SQL

Создание таблицы - команда CREATE TABLE (SQL для Начинающих)

Уроки по SQL | Создание таблиц, добавление данных | Связь один к одному

Похожие статьи:

Как хранить изображение в SQL: лучшие способы для оптимизации базы данных

Какой оператор SQL используется для создания таблицы в базе данных?

Какой тип данных у телефона в SQL